# EchoHall audio-guide app — staging env. Reviewed per release.
# Serves tour audio for the Varnholt Museum pilot. CDN origin is
# pinned; do not change without checking the transcode worker.
# Playback analytics are batched nightly; flag below toggles that.
# Locale packs load from the assets bucket at boot. Keep this file
# out of commits; CI injects it. The streaming backend requires a
# signing key to mint audio URLs. That key goes on the line below.

env line for fafof-fahag: LEDGER_TOKEN5=f8790

Action item: The Relayn deploy-status bot silently dropped updates when the pipeline API paginated results, so responders believed a rollback had completed when it had not. We will add pagination handling, a staleness banner, and an integration test. Until merged, verify deploy state directly in the pipeline console, documented at the page below.

runbook for kahop-kajop: https://rundeck.ordinio.test/display/secrets/pipeline/issue/pages/repo/browse/e5732776e07d1285107e5aeb

Subject: Cut-over done — GC pauses on Matchwell

Hi, welcome aboard! Quick recap: we finished the cut-over of the Matchwell matching service to the new Zelda runtime last night. The old setup was hitting 800ms GC pauses during peak matching windows; the new collector keeps us under 40ms. If you're poking around, the service now runs with the following configuration.

settings of fawip-yadug:
[druath]
port = 3000
region = north-4
host = druath.qirvanworks.corp
timeout_ms = 1500
retries = 1

### Offline Mode Setup

Welcome to TrailNote! When surveyors lose signal out in the field, the app queues responses locally and syncs once it reconnects. For that sync to work, your dev build needs to authenticate against our internal sync broker — it won't accept anonymous uploads, even queued ones. Drop the broker key into `local.settings` before your first run. For convenience, the current dev key is pasted here.

gateway credential: kto3_qfe